Frequently Asked Questions

Q1: What is HJT (Heterojunction) technology?
HJT combines the best of crystalline silicon and thin-film technologies, offering higher efficiency, better performance in low light, and a lower temperature coefficient than standard PERC panels.
Q2: Why are bifacial solar panels advantageous?
Bifacial panels can capture sunlight from both the front and rear sides. When installed on reflective surfaces (like white roofs or gravel), they can increase energy yield by up to 10-25%.
Q3: What is the warranty period for these solar panels?
These N-type HJT panels typically come with a 30-year power warranty, ensuring long-term reliability and minimal degradation over decades of use.
Q4: How does the IP68 junction box benefit the system?
An IP68 rating means the junction box is completely dust-tight and can withstand permanent immersion in water, ensuring safety and durability in extreme weather conditions.

Q6: What is the significance of the 2.0mm dual glass design?
Dual glass construction provides superior mechanical strength, better fire resistance, and protection against moisture ingress, which significantly reduces the risk of PID (Potential Induced Degradation).
